Floatzel, the Sea Weasel Pokémon, is a Water-type creature introduced in Generation IV of the Pokémon franchise. It evolves from Buizel starting at level 26. Floatzel is known for its well-developed flotation sac, which allows it to float on water and assist in the rescues of drowning people, as highlighted in its Pokédex entries. Its sleek, aerodynamic body and two tails, which resemble propellers, enable it to swim at incredible speeds. Floatzel often inhabits rivers and coastal areas, where it can be seen darting through the water. Its diet primarily consists of fish and other aquatic life, which it hunts with remarkable agility. In the anime, Floatzel is notably featured as one of Crasher Wake's Pokémon, a Gym Leader known for his Water-type specialists, and also as one of Ash's Pokémon, evolving from his Buizel. Its design, reminiscent of a sea otter or weasel, contributes to its appeal as a swift and capable aquatic Pokémon. The Water type gives Floatzel a strong matchup against Fire, Ground, and Rock types, while being vulnerable to Electric and Grass types. Floatzel's role in the games often emphasizes its speed and offensive capabilities, making it a valuable asset in many trainers' teams. Its unique ability to use its flotation sac for rescue operations also adds to its gentle yet powerful image.
